新聞中心
隨著互聯(lián)網(wǎng)和數(shù)字化時(shí)代的到來,各種企業(yè)、機(jī)構(gòu)和組織都開始使用數(shù)據(jù)庫應(yīng)用系統(tǒng)來管理和處理數(shù)據(jù)。在開發(fā)數(shù)據(jù)庫應(yīng)用系統(tǒng)時(shí),設(shè)計(jì)是十分重要的環(huán)節(jié),它直接影響著系統(tǒng)的性能、穩(wěn)定性和用戶體驗(yàn)。本文將從要點(diǎn)和注意事項(xiàng)兩個(gè)方面,探討數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)的關(guān)鍵問題。

阿壩州ssl適用于網(wǎng)站、小程序/APP、API接口等需要進(jìn)行數(shù)據(jù)傳輸應(yīng)用場景,ssl證書未來市場廣闊!成為創(chuàng)新互聯(lián)建站的ssl證書銷售渠道,可以享受市場價(jià)格4-6折優(yōu)惠!如果有意向歡迎電話聯(lián)系或者加微信:13518219792(備注:SSL證書合作)期待與您的合作!
一、要點(diǎn)
1.數(shù)據(jù)庫選擇
在設(shè)計(jì)數(shù)據(jù)庫應(yīng)用系統(tǒng)時(shí),首要的決策是數(shù)據(jù)庫的選擇。常見的數(shù)據(jù)庫有Oracle、MySQL、SQL Server、PostgreSQL等。選擇哪種數(shù)據(jù)庫要考慮實(shí)際業(yè)務(wù)需求、數(shù)據(jù)量大小、性能需求和數(shù)據(jù)安全等因素。對于小型應(yīng)用系統(tǒng)和數(shù)據(jù)量不大的中小企業(yè),可以選擇MySQL和PostgreSQL等開源數(shù)據(jù)庫,而對于大型企業(yè)和海量數(shù)據(jù),更加適合選擇Oracle和SQL Server等商業(yè)數(shù)據(jù)庫。
2.數(shù)據(jù)結(jié)構(gòu)設(shè)計(jì)
數(shù)據(jù)結(jié)構(gòu)設(shè)計(jì)是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)的核心環(huán)節(jié)。它直接影響著數(shù)據(jù)在系統(tǒng)中的存儲(chǔ)方式和操作效率。好的數(shù)據(jù)結(jié)構(gòu)設(shè)計(jì)應(yīng)該考慮到業(yè)務(wù)需求、數(shù)據(jù)查詢和分析需求、數(shù)據(jù)實(shí)時(shí)性要求、系統(tǒng)的可維護(hù)性以及數(shù)據(jù)安全性等方面。在設(shè)計(jì)數(shù)據(jù)結(jié)構(gòu)時(shí),要遵循關(guān)系數(shù)據(jù)庫設(shè)計(jì)規(guī)范,盡可能將數(shù)據(jù)庫規(guī)范化,避免數(shù)據(jù)冗余和數(shù)據(jù)異常。
3.系統(tǒng)架構(gòu)設(shè)計(jì)
系統(tǒng)架構(gòu)設(shè)計(jì)是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中不可忽略的環(huán)節(jié)。合理的系統(tǒng)架構(gòu)可以確保系統(tǒng)的穩(wěn)定性和可維護(hù)性,并且可以提高操作和管理效率。在系統(tǒng)架構(gòu)設(shè)計(jì)中,需要考慮到數(shù)據(jù)庫的物理存儲(chǔ)方式、應(yīng)用服務(wù)器和Web服務(wù)器的部署方式,以及數(shù)據(jù)庫和應(yīng)用服務(wù)器之間的通信方式等問題。
4.性能優(yōu)化設(shè)計(jì)
性能優(yōu)化設(shè)計(jì)是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中的關(guān)鍵環(huán)節(jié)。好的性能優(yōu)化設(shè)計(jì)可以提高系統(tǒng)的響應(yīng)速度和吞吐量,減少機(jī)器資源的占用,降低系統(tǒng)的維護(hù)成本。在性能優(yōu)化設(shè)計(jì)中,要從數(shù)據(jù)庫的基本設(shè)置、索引設(shè)計(jì)、查詢優(yōu)化、存儲(chǔ)過程和觸發(fā)器設(shè)計(jì)等方面著手,在保障數(shù)據(jù)完整性和安全性的前提下,盡可能提高系統(tǒng)的性能。
5.數(shù)據(jù)備份和恢復(fù)設(shè)計(jì)
數(shù)據(jù)備份和恢復(fù)設(shè)計(jì)是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)的最后一個(gè)環(huán)節(jié),但其重要性卻不可忽視。在系統(tǒng)運(yùn)行中,數(shù)據(jù)意外丟失或損壞時(shí),數(shù)據(jù)備份和恢復(fù)能夠有效地保證數(shù)據(jù)完整性和持久性。在設(shè)計(jì)數(shù)據(jù)備份和恢復(fù)時(shí),要考慮到備份和恢復(fù)的速度、數(shù)據(jù)恢復(fù)的粒度、備份存儲(chǔ)和恢復(fù)的方便性等因素。
二、注意事項(xiàng)
1.數(shù)據(jù)安全
數(shù)據(jù)安全是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中必須重視的問題。在系統(tǒng)設(shè)計(jì)過程中,要考慮到數(shù)據(jù)的機(jī)密性、完整性、可用性和可追溯性等要素,避免數(shù)據(jù)被非法獲取、篡改或破壞。為此,需要采取訪問控制、備份和恢復(fù)、加密技術(shù)、審計(jì)追蹤等手段,保障數(shù)據(jù)的安全性。
2.系統(tǒng)可維護(hù)性
系統(tǒng)可維護(hù)性是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中必須關(guān)注的問題。合理的系統(tǒng)架構(gòu)設(shè)計(jì)和數(shù)據(jù)結(jié)構(gòu)設(shè)計(jì)可以提高系統(tǒng)的可維護(hù)性。在系統(tǒng)設(shè)計(jì)中,應(yīng)考慮到模塊化設(shè)計(jì)、統(tǒng)一編碼規(guī)范、日志記錄等方面,以便于程序員對系統(tǒng)進(jìn)行維護(hù)和調(diào)試。
3.用戶體驗(yàn)
用戶體驗(yàn)是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中需要重視的問題。優(yōu)秀的用戶體驗(yàn)可以提高用戶的滿意度和使用率,從而提高系統(tǒng)的價(jià)值。在用戶體驗(yàn)設(shè)計(jì)中,需要考慮到UI設(shè)計(jì)、響應(yīng)速度、交互方式、錯(cuò)誤提示等要素,盡可能方便用戶的使用。
4.數(shù)據(jù)一致性
數(shù)據(jù)一致性是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中不可忽視的問題。在設(shè)計(jì)數(shù)據(jù)結(jié)構(gòu)時(shí),需要考慮到數(shù)據(jù)之間的關(guān)系,避免數(shù)據(jù)冗余和數(shù)據(jù)異常。在系統(tǒng)運(yùn)行中,需要保證數(shù)據(jù)的一致性,在修改數(shù)據(jù)時(shí),應(yīng)維護(hù)數(shù)據(jù)的完整性,并保證事務(wù)的原子性、一致性、隔離性和持久性。
5.系統(tǒng)可擴(kuò)展性
系統(tǒng)可擴(kuò)展性是數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)中必須考慮的問題。在系統(tǒng)設(shè)計(jì)時(shí),應(yīng)預(yù)留出足夠的擴(kuò)展余地,能夠適應(yīng)未來業(yè)務(wù)需求的擴(kuò)展和變化。同時(shí),在系統(tǒng)設(shè)計(jì)中,應(yīng)考慮到系統(tǒng)負(fù)載均衡、集群、分布式等方面,以便于系統(tǒng)的擴(kuò)展和升級(jí)。
三、 結(jié)論
作為一種重要的信息技術(shù)應(yīng)用,數(shù)據(jù)庫應(yīng)用系統(tǒng)在各個(gè)領(lǐng)域中有著廣泛的應(yīng)用。設(shè)計(jì)好的數(shù)據(jù)庫應(yīng)用系統(tǒng)可以提高數(shù)據(jù)處理的效率,增強(qiáng)數(shù)據(jù)分析的能力,提高數(shù)據(jù)的安全性和一致性。在設(shè)計(jì)數(shù)據(jù)庫應(yīng)用系統(tǒng)時(shí),需要從要點(diǎn)和注意事項(xiàng)兩方面出發(fā),綜合多方面因素,設(shè)計(jì)出安全、高效、可擴(kuò)展、易維護(hù)的數(shù)據(jù)庫應(yīng)用系統(tǒng),以滿足用戶的需求和期望。
成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ián)為您提供網(wǎng)站建設(shè)、網(wǎng)站制作、網(wǎng)頁設(shè)計(jì)及定制高端網(wǎng)站建設(shè)服務(wù)!
簡述數(shù)據(jù)庫應(yīng)用系統(tǒng)的開發(fā)設(shè)計(jì)步驟
數(shù)據(jù)庫應(yīng)用系統(tǒng)的開發(fā)是一項(xiàng)軟件工程。一般可分為以下幾個(gè)階段:
1.規(guī)劃2.需求分析3.概念模型設(shè)計(jì)4. 邏輯設(shè)計(jì)5.物理設(shè)計(jì)6.程序編制及調(diào)試7.運(yùn)行及維護(hù)。這些階段的劃分目前尚無尺襲統(tǒng)一的標(biāo)準(zhǔn),各階段間相互聯(lián)接,而且常常需要回溯修正。在數(shù)據(jù)庫應(yīng)用系統(tǒng)的開發(fā)過程中,每個(gè)階段的工作成果就是寫出相應(yīng)的文檔。每個(gè)階段都是在上一階段工作成果的基礎(chǔ)上枯槐繼續(xù)進(jìn)行,整個(gè)開發(fā)工程是有依據(jù)、有組織、有計(jì)劃、有條不陵敗兄紊地展開工作。
數(shù)據(jù)庫應(yīng)用系統(tǒng)的設(shè)計(jì)包括的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于數(shù)據(jù)庫應(yīng)用系統(tǒng)的設(shè)計(jì)包括,數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)的要點(diǎn)及注意事項(xiàng),簡述數(shù)據(jù)庫應(yīng)用系統(tǒng)的開發(fā)設(shè)計(jì)步驟的信息別忘了在本站進(jìn)行查找喔。
香港云服務(wù)器機(jī)房,創(chuàng)新互聯(lián)(www.cdcxhl.com)專業(yè)云服務(wù)器廠商,回大陸優(yōu)化帶寬,安全/穩(wěn)定/低延遲.創(chuàng)新互聯(lián)助力企業(yè)出海業(yè)務(wù),提供一站式解決方案。香港服務(wù)器-免備案低延遲-雙向CN2+BGP極速互訪!
本文標(biāo)題:數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)的要點(diǎn)及注意事項(xiàng)(數(shù)據(jù)庫應(yīng)用系統(tǒng)的設(shè)計(jì)包括)
轉(zhuǎn)載來源:http://www.5511xx.com/article/dhodhpi.html


咨詢
建站咨詢
